Care
for Self Watering plants
Our
self watering plant is an unconventional pot of plant. With a built
in self-contained absorbent base that acts as a water reservoir to
soak up and store excess water. A water indicator will clear display
the water level and need for watering. Appropriate amount of moisture
will be released into the plants over a period
of up to 60 days. ( subjected to variation )

Care
for Self watering plant
Unlike
in the nature, these are grown in a container and rely on what you
feed them. Water them with our specially formulated nutrients. A
healthy and happy plant will bring about many months of enjoyment.
1. Trim
off dead leaves regularly
2. Provide
good lighting
3. Allow
the potting mix to dry slightly for about 3 to 7 days before adding
the next cycle of nutrients
4. Avoid
overfeeding
